#include <stdlib.h>
#include <unistd.h>
/*
* C standard function: exit process.
*/
void
exit(int code)
{
/*
* In a more complicated libc, this would call functions registered
* with atexit() before calling the syscall to actually exit.
*/
#ifdef __mips__
/*
* Because gcc knows that _exit doesn't return, if we call it
* directly it will drop any code that follows it. This means
* that if _exit *does* return, as happens before it's
* implemented, undefined and usually weird behavior ensues.
*
* As a hack (this is quite gross) do the call by hand in an
* asm block. Then gcc doesn't know what it is, and won't
* optimize the following code out, and we can make sure
* that exit() at least really does not return.
*
* This asm block violates gcc's asm rules by destroying a
* register it doesn't declare ($4, which is a0) but this
* hopefully doesn't matter as the only local it can lose
* track of is "code" and we don't use it afterwards.
*/
__asm volatile("jal _exit;" /* call _exit */
"move $4, %0" /* put code in a0 (delay slot) */
: /* no outputs */
: "r" (code)); /* code is an input */
/*
* Ok, exiting doesn't work; see if we can get our process
* killed by making an illegal memory access. Use a magic
* number address so the symptoms are recognizable and
* unlikely to occur by accident otherwise.
*/
__asm volatile("li $2, 0xeeeee00f;" /* load magic addr into v0 */
"lw $2, 0($2)" /* fetch from it */
:: ); /* no args */
#else
_exit(code);
#endif
/*
* We can't return; so if we can't exit, the only other choice
* is to loop.
*/
while (1) { }
}
